Smoke

I'm not sure how the rest of the world is doing but Northern Ca. is trying to burn up! My house is in no big danger from any of the four fires that are burning around it but a person can't breath or see across the driveway.The air taste like you are sucking on a smoked pine cone and your eyes burn all the time . I'm looking forward to a good rain with NO lighting attached to it. I feel so sorry for those who have lost everything this last two weeks despite the gallant attempts of the fire fighters to save home and property, this has to end sometime soon there is only so much the fire fighters can endure in 100+ heat.. Lost again somewhere in the smoke....Tedd

We went to Hot August Nights and encountered some smoke on our way there on Hwy 44 from Old Station to Susanville on August 5th. Then, on our return August 12th, there was tons of smoke, starting around Doyle on Hwy 395 and it really got bad on Hwys 36 & 44 out of Susanville. It stayed that way through Old Station and Hwy 89 until we crossed Hwy 299 and then it cleared up. I can't begin to imagine what it's like there now. When we went through on the 12th, the sun was just a pinhole of light through the smoke. I'm thinking now the sun might not be getting through at all!
